In general, cooked baked beans can last in the fridge for 3 to 5 days if properly stored. Normally, canned baked beans have a shelf life of about 2 to 5 years if stored in a cool and dry place, which is not in the refrigerator. When it comes to storing baked beans in the fridge, the general guideline is to consume them within 3 to 4 days of opening the can or cooking.
